Maintenance
If you take care of it, your leather sectional will remain a cherished part of your home for many years to come. It's just a matter of easy steps to keep it in perfect condition, especially when you are using it frequently.
Vacuum the sofa sleeper couch regularly, paying special attention to areas that are difficult to reach, such as corners and crevices. This will help remove any loose dirt and debris that may have accumulated. Use a soft brush to avoid scratching delicate leather surfaces.
If you've got any lingering staining marks on your sleeper sofa made of leather, make use of a leather cleaner. It will lift and eliminate the stain. You can also mix a solution of mild soap and water to wipe the sofa surface, rinsing the cloth frequently. Beware of using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ners since they can harm the leather surface over time.
Another way to protect your leather sofa is by putting up barriers that protect. Consider installing window treatments to block UV rays, or using pillows or furniture covers to protect upholstery fabrics from exposure to light.
Also, plan professional cleaning on a regular basis to avoid permanent damage to your sleeper sofa. A reputable upholstery cleaner applies conditioner to the Leather sleeper couch to restore and protect the natural oils. This prevents the leather from drying out and becoming brittle over time. To get the best sleeper couch results, always request your upholstery cleaner to test their products on a small portion of your sofa prior to applying them to your entire couch.
